After hours of intense combat and resounding silence on the frontline, a newly published post-fight interview with frontline soldiers delivers rare, candid insight into the psychological and tactical realities of war. Far from the sanitized narratives often amplified in media, these warriors speak plainly about fear, camaraderie, and the unbearable weight of split-second decisions. Their stories, marked by raw honesty and discipline, challenge public perceptions and underscore the profound human cost behind conflict.
In the quiet hours following a high-stakes engagement, operatives from multiple frontlines convened with journalists for an unfiltered post-fight reflection—an event that has become increasingly rare in an era of controlled narratives.These soldiers, many decorated yet visibly fatigued, offered a rare glimpse into the chaos of combat and the resilience required to endure it. “Every time you fire that weapon or leap across open ground, your mind splits into two worlds: one of instinct, one of memory,” described Sergeant Marcus Delgado, a combat medic based in the region. “You’re trained to act, but your brain doesn’t always follow orders—it remembers family, fear, and what was lost.
That split weight you feel? It’s not just bullets; it’s a lifetime of threats folded into seconds.” The interview reveals a complex psychological landscape shaped by constant exposure to violence. While tactical precision is routinely praised, soldiers emphasize that mental endurance is the true battlefield.
**The Mental War:** - Over 87% of respondents reported recurring intrusive thoughts after deployment. - nearly half depend on peer support and structured debriefings to process trauma. - Many highlight guilt—survivors’ guilt looms as heavy as the physical injuries.
- “You never expect to cry in the trenches,” shared another soldier, whose voice cracked with restraint. “But when the silence hits, it’s a different kind of fight.” Tactical excellence, though flawlessly executed, proves incomplete without addressing the emotional toll. Units now advocate for integrated mental health support as foundational as physical readiness.
One platoon commander noted, “We train for the mission—but the war doesn’t end when the orders stop. Healing starts after the last round is fired.” Technology and doctrine evolve rapidly, but human response remains deeply personal. Soldiers describe cutting-edge devices reducing exposure, yet the instinct to protect—both teams and civilians—remains unchanged.
“Drones change how we fight,” said Captain Elena Ruiz, “but they don’t change what you feel when you see a young face in the dust.” Historical parallels surface: veterans from past conflicts echo similar psychological burdens, suggesting these experiences transcend time and technology.
